How long is the drive through Nebraska?

Nebraska’s Lincoln Highway Historic Byway is the only byway that crosses the entire state at 498 miles long. In fact, it is part of U.S. 30 which is the shortest and most direct route between New York and San Francisco. It was one of the first transcontinental highways across the U.S. for automobiles.

What is it like driving through Nebraska?

It is generally flat. The major highway system in Nebraska is Interstate 80. It goes through the Platte River Valley from roughly York, Nebraska to the end of the state. The areas from Omaha past Lincoln to York has rolling hills that go up and down.

What does a learner’s permit in Nebraska mean?

The Learner’s Permit (LPD) is issued to allow a person to legally practice driving for a Provisional Operator’s Permit (POP), Operator’s (Class O) or Motorcycle (Class M) License.
